WebThe Importance of Anger. Being good-tempered does not mean tolerating unpleasant or bad behaviour, or never getting angry. Being too malleable or persuasive is not the same as being good-tempered. The man who is angry at the right things and with the right people, and, further, as he ought when he ought, and as long as he ought is praised.
